SZ DJI Technology Co., Ltd. (大疆创新) is the world's dominant drone manufacturer founded in 2006 by Frank Wang Tao and headquartered at DJI Sky City, No. 55, Xianyuan Road, Nanshan District, Shenzhen, Guangdong 518057, China. The company has evolved from a college dorm room startup to a global technology leader with over 10,000 employees and commanding 90% market share across consumer drone segments as of 2024, representing unprecedented industry dominance. DJI achieved a $15 billion valuation in 2018 following its Series D funding round, with total capital raised of $105 million from tier-one investors including Accel Partners, Sequoia Capital China, and GIC, though the relatively modest funding reflects strong organic cash generation. The company's strategic location in Shenzhen provides direct access to China's Silicon Valley ecosystem, enabling rapid innovation cycles and supply chain optimization that competitors struggle to match. Historical revenue reached 17.6 billion yuan ($2.8 billion) in 2017 with compound annual growth exceeding 80% during peak years, though recent figures remain private due to regulatory pressures and geopolitical tensions affecting transparency. DJI's privately-held structure under Frank Wang's controlling interest (45% ownership) allows strategic focus on long-term innovation rather than quarterly earnings pressures, though this limits public market access for growth capital during expansion phases. DJI has raised $105 million across six funding rounds since 2014, starting with early-stage investments from Professor Li Zexiang and progressing through Series A ($10M), Series B ($75M from Accel Partners), and Series C rounds, demonstrating remarkable capital efficiency given its market dominance and revenue scale. The company achieved unicorn status in 2015 with a $10 billion valuation and reached $15 billion valuation by 2018, representing sustainable growth supported by strong fundamentals rather than speculative expansion typical of venture-backed companies. Strategic investors include Accel Partners, Sequoia Capital China, GIC (Singapore sovereign wealth fund), Kleiner Perkins, and New Horizon Capital, with state-affiliated entities representing less than 4.3% ownership and 0.5% voting rights, contradicting US government claims of state control. Historical revenue growth from 5 billion yuan in 2013 to 17.6 billion yuan in 2017 demonstrates 37% compound annual growth rate with strong unit economics evidenced by gross margins exceeding 40% and operational leverage improving as scale increases. Question 1: How should the Board address the US Department of Defense "Chinese Military Company" designation and its impact on long-term market access?

The Chinese Military Company designation represents DJI's most significant strategic threat, with the company currently engaged in federal litigation challenging the Pentagon's decision while facing operational restrictions across multiple US government agencies and state-level procurement bans. DJI's legal strategy focuses on demonstrating independence from Chinese military influence, with founder Frank Wang and early investors controlling 88% of equity and 99.3% of voting rights while state-owned entities own only 4.3% of shares and 0.5% of votes, falling well below ownership thresholds typically required for control designations. The company has established comprehensive compliance programs including the 2024 Trust Center publishing third-party audits, security certifications, and privacy controls, while implementing local data processing and on-premises deployment options to address national security concerns. Financial impact includes terminated government contracts, restricted access to federal agencies that previously relied on DJI platforms for emergency response and infrastructure inspection, and reputational damage affecting commercial sales despite no proven evidence of data exfiltration or unauthorized transmissions.
